Subject: usb-storage: Fix scsi-sd failure "Invalid field in cdb" for USB
adapter JMicron
commit 9fa62b1a31c96715aef34f25000e882ed4ac4876 upstream.
The patch extends the family of SATA-to-USB JMicron adapters that need
FUA to be disabled and applies the same policy for uas driver.
